Engineering jobs in the UK cover a wide spectrum, including roles in civil, mechanical, electrical, and software engineering. Opportunities range from designing infrastructure to developing cutting-edge technology. Engineers may work in construction, energy, aerospace, or IT sectors. Key skills involve problem-solving, technical expertise, and project management. The industry demands adaptability to technological advancements and a commitment to safety standards. Challenges include tight project deadlines and staying abreast of evolving technologies. Despite these challenges, engineering jobs in the UK remain vital for innovation and infrastructure development, offering diverse career paths and contributing significantly to the country's economic growth.
